Specifications

The Springfield Marine 1300750-R1 Flat Sided Aluminum Base Right comes with a clear set of specifications designed for marine use. It features a 9″ x 7″ right flat side base, which is crucial for providing a stable mounting surface with a specific orientation. The requirement for a 3-3/4″ deck hole is a standard that simplifies installation into many existing boat structures.

This base is constructed from aluminum with a rust-resistant satin finish, a critical feature for longevity in a marine environment. It’s designed to work with any 2-3/8″ plug-in post (which must be purchased separately), offering flexibility in seat post selection. The product is backed by a 5-year warranty, indicating the manufacturer’s confidence in its durability.

These specifications matter because they dictate compatibility and performance. The specific dimensions of the base and the deck hole requirement ensure it can be securely fitted without excessive modification, while the aluminum construction and satin finish are key to preventing corrosion. The 2-3/8″ post compatibility is a common standard, making it easy to find a suitable partner post for your seat.
